is het mogelijk om jpg om te zetten naar png

Overzicht Reageren

Sponsored by: Vacatures door Monsterboard

Ralph van der Tang

ralph van der Tang

30/05/2013 09:36:12
Quote Anchor link
hoi iedereen is het mogelijk om een jpg of jpeg plaatje om te zetten naar een png
dit heb ik nodig omdat de website waar ik aan werk eigen alleen maar pngs ondersteund

Mvg ralph

dit is wat ik heb nu: (werkt niet geeft error)

<b>Warning</b>: imagecreatefromjpeg() expects exactly 1 parameter, 2 given in <b>D:\Program Files\devel\xampp\htdocs\git\Business-leaders\controller\adminajax_controller.php</b> on line <b>1441</b><br />

de code waar de error mijn inziens moet zitten
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
4
5
6
7
8
9
10
11
12
13
<?php
$tmp
=$_FILES['profielFoto']['tmp_name'];
                        
                        if($ext =='jpeg' || $ext ='jpg')
                            {

                                $tmp=imagecreatefromjpeg(file_get_contents($_FILES['profielFoto']['tmp_name']), "".$id.".png");
                            }

                            else
                            {
                                // tijdelijke servernaam
                                $tmp=$_FILES['profielFoto']['tmp_name'];
                            }

?>
Gewijzigd op 30/05/2013 09:37:32 door Ralph van der Tang
 
PHP hulp

PHP hulp

22/11/2024 10:50:45
 
B a s
Beheerder

B a s

30/05/2013 09:46:31
Quote Anchor link
Die error betekent dat je twee parameters gebruikt en er maar één moet gebruiken:

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
<?php
$tmp
=imagecreatefromjpeg(file_get_contents($_FILES['profielFoto']['tmp_name']), "".$id.".png");
?>


Dat zou moeten zijn:

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
<?php
$tmp
=imagecreatefromjpeg(file_get_contents($_FILES['profielFoto']['tmp_name']) . $id.".png");
?>


Maar om je vraag te beantwoorden. JPG to PNG kun je bereiken dmv:

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
3
<?php
imagepng(imagecreatefromstring(file_get_contents($_FILES['profielFoto']['tmp_name'])), $id . '.png');
?>
 



Overzicht Reageren

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.